** The Toyota repair market serving Nelson, CA, is centralized in the Fresno/Clovis metropolitan area. The market is robust and competitive, offering a clear choice between factory-authorized dealerships and high-quality independent specialists. * **Average Quality:** The quality is generally high. The dealership (Toyota of Fresno) sets the benchmark for factory-standard procedures and hybrid system expertise. The top independents compete effectively by offering more personalized service, often at a lower labor rate, while leveraging deep, brand-specific experience. * **Competition Level:** Competition is strong, which benefits the consumer. Shops compete on reputation, specialization, and pricing. Customers have clear options for different needs: the dealership for warranty and cutting-edge hybrid tech, and independents for long-term maintenance, engine/transmission overhauls, and cost-effective repairs. * **Typical Pricing:** Pricing follows a standard tiered structure. Dealership labor rates are typically the highest, reflecting their overhead and factory training. Independent specialists offer more competitive labor rates, usually 15-25% lower, while still providing OEM or high-quality aftermarket parts. This makes the independents an attractive option for out-of-warranty vehicles.
